Album Rating: 3.5 | Sound Off
The new collaboration with Tropical Fuck Storm, is where it's at! Satanic Slumber Party.
From Tropical Fuck Storm's bandcamp
"Somewhere along a frayed thread of time, a King Gizz and a Tropical Fuck Storm convened under the cloak of night for a slumber party of the satanic persuasion…Pumped full of booze and adrenaline, two of psych-rock’s most powerful joined forces for a 20-minute “Hatjam” chockfull of sax skronks, brick-heavy distortion, and punchy riffs. Satanic Slumber Party arrives just in time for your possessed pleasure."
